>> Have I missed something here? You can get an Al-book to boot into OS9? IIRC, 
>> the last OS9-bootable machines were the top-end Ti-books (867MHz and 1GHz) 
>> which can boot into native 9, Tiger and Leopard. 
>> 
>> Macs younger than that can only boot OSX, then have Classic as an OSX 
>> process, so long as they're running Tiger. For Leopard and SnowLeopard, I 
>> use SheepShaver to emulate OS9. It's fairly stable and does the job but, as 
>> you say, isn't as nice as native, booting OS9.
